/*
 * scorefile.c: Rog-O-Matic XIV (CMU) Mon Jan  7 17:20:52 1985 - mlm
 * Copyright (C) 1985 by A. Appel, G. Jacobson, L. Hamey, and M. Mauldin
 *
 * This file contains the functions which update the rogomatic scorefile,
 * which lives in <RGMDIR>/rgmscore<versionstr>. LOCKFILE is used to
 * prevent simultaneous accesses to the file. rgmdelta<versionstr>
 * contains new scores, and whenever the score file is printed the delta
 * file is sorted and merged into the rgmscore file.
 */
